I'm new to Pro/Mechanica so please bear with me !!

Does anyone have any 'tips' or 'suggestions' for creating good quality .mpg files. The file I did create is of very poor quality (even though I did select high quality !!).

Using the "Custom" option in the Export Mpeg dialog box lets you crank up the resolution up to 720 x 480 ...

Its better than the default options that Mechanica gives you...

Snagit and Camtasia are great alternatives though. I use Snagit on a daily basis..
